Subject: [patch 4/4] reiserfs: allow exposing privroot w/ xattrs enabled
Date: Sun, 17 May 2009 01:02:04 -0400 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20090517050332.566856122@suse.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: 20090517050200.786752018@suse.com
[-- Attachment #1: patches.fixes/reiserfs-expose-privroot --]
[-- Type: text/plain, Size: 2580 bytes --]
--- a/fs/reiserfs/dir.c
+++ b/fs/reiserfs/dir.c
@@ -44,13 +44,11 @@ static int reiserfs_dir_fsync(struct fil
static inline bool is_privroot_deh(struct dentry *dir,
struct reiserfs_de_head *deh)
{
- int ret = 0;
-#ifdef CONFIG_REISERFS_FS_XATTR
struct dentry *privroot = REISERFS_SB(dir->d_sb)->priv_root;
- ret = (dir == dir->d_parent && privroot->d_inode &&
- deh->deh_objectid == INODE_PKEY(privroot->d_inode)->k_objectid);
-#endif
- return ret;
+ if (reiserfs_expose_privroot(dir->d_sb))
+ return 0;
+ return (dir == dir->d_parent && privroot->d_inode &&
+ deh->deh_objectid == INODE_PKEY(privroot->d_inode)->k_objectid);
}
int reiserfs_readdir_dentry(struct dentry *dentry, void *dirent,
--- a/fs/reiserfs/super.c
+++ b/fs/reiserfs/super.c
@@ -898,6 +898,7 @@ static int reiserfs_parse_options(struct
{"conv",.setmask = 1 << REISERFS_CONVERT},
{"attrs",.setmask = 1 << REISERFS_ATTRS},
{"noattrs",.clrmask = 1 << REISERFS_ATTRS},
+ {"expose_privroot", .setmask = 1 << REISERFS_EXPOSE_PRIVROOT},
#ifdef CONFIG_REISERFS_FS_XATTR
{"user_xattr",.setmask = 1 << REISERFS_XATTRS_USER},
{"nouser_xattr",.clrmask = 1 << REISERFS_XATTRS_USER},
--- a/fs/reiserfs/xattr.c
+++ b/fs/reiserfs/xattr.c
@@ -982,7 +982,8 @@ int reiserfs_lookup_privroot(struct supe
strlen(PRIVROOT_NAME));
if (!IS_ERR(dentry)) {
REISERFS_SB(s)->priv_root = dentry;
- s->s_root->d_op = &xattr_lookup_poison_ops;
+ if (!reiserfs_expose_privroot(s))
+ s->s_root->d_op = &xattr_lookup_poison_ops;
if (dentry->d_inode)
dentry->d_inode->i_flags |= S_PRIVATE;
} else
--- a/include/linux/reiserfs_fs_sb.h
+++ b/include/linux/reiserfs_fs_sb.h
@@ -453,6 +453,7 @@ enum reiserfs_mount_options {
REISERFS_ATTRS,
REISERFS_XATTRS_USER,
REISERFS_POSIXACL,
+ REISERFS_EXPOSE_PRIVROOT,
REISERFS_BARRIER_NONE,
REISERFS_BARRIER_FLUSH,
@@ -490,6 +491,7 @@ enum reiserfs_mount_options {
#define reiserfs_data_writeback(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_DATA_WRITEBACK))
#define reiserfs_xattrs_user(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_XATTRS_USER))
#define reiserfs_posixacl(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_POSIXACL))
+#define reiserfs_expose_privroot(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_EXPOSE_PRIVROOT))
#define reiserfs_xattrs_optional(s) (reiserfs_xattrs_user(s) || reiserfs_posixacl(s))
#define reiserfs_barrier_none(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_BARRIER_NONE))
#define reiserfs_barrier_flush(s) (REISERFS_SB(s)->s_mount_opt & (1 << REISERFS_BARRIER_FLUSH))
